Sat 786343309017242

decimal
157268.3309017242
degree
0°157268′20″3309017242‴
percentile
37.444919518200955%
name
igxpsffemnn
cycle
0
epoch
0
period
78
block
157268
offset
3309017242
timestamp
rarity
common